  1. INSPECT GARAGE DOOR OPENER 

    Press the switch and check that each LED (red) lights up.

    Even if only one switch is found not to light up, replace it.

  2. INSPECT GARAGE DOOR OPENER REGISTRATION AND TRANSMITTING 

    HINT:

    Use the home link tester made by KENT MORE for this test. As it is necessary to record the code of the hand held transmitter, customer's code will be erased. When the inspection completes, please register the customer's again.

    1. Check that the code of hand held transmitter for inspection can be recorded.

      If the code can not be registered, replace garage door opener.

    2. Press the switch which an inspection code has been registered for and check that LED (green) of the home link tester lights up.

      If the LED (green) does not light up, replace the garage door opener.
